Automate the Boring Stuff with Python, 2nd Edition: Praktyczne programowanie dla początkujących

Ocena:   (4,7 na 5)

Automate the Boring Stuff with Python, 2nd Edition: Praktyczne programowanie dla początkujących (Al Sweigart)

Opinie czytelników

Podsumowanie:

Książka „Automate the Boring Stuff with Python” została ogólnie dobrze przyjęta, szczególnie ze względu na jasne wyjaśnienia, praktyczne zastosowania i dostępność dla początkujących. Została jednak skrytykowana za słabe formatowanie przykładów i niekompletny kod, szczególnie w wersji Kindle. Chociaż wielu uważa, że książka jest nieoceniona w nauce Pythona, niektórzy uważają, że może prowadzić do złych nawyków kodowania ze względu na swoje podejście.

Zalety:

Doskonałe wyjaśnienia, które są łatwe do zrozumienia dla początkujących.
Sekcja regex jest szczególnie chwalona jako najlepsze napotkane wyjaśnienie.
Świetnie nadaje się do praktycznych zastosowań i projektów, dzięki czemu nauka Pythona jest wciągająca.
Podejście książki jest przyjazne dla różnych poziomów umiejętności, od nie-programistów do doświadczonych deweloperów.
Wysokiej jakości druk fizyczny.
Szerokie wsparcie społeczności i dostępne zasoby uzupełniające.

Wady:

Słabe formatowanie w wersji Kindle prowadzi do problemów z wcięciami kodu i powielaniem przykładów.
Niektóre przykłady są niekompletne lub nieefektywne, co może prowadzić do złych nawyków programistycznych dla początkujących.
Krytyka dotycząca braku jasności w niektórych wyjaśnieniach.
Przykłady kodu mogą nie być dobrze dopasowane do najlepszych praktyk, komplikując naukę prawdziwym nowicjuszom.

(na podstawie 260 opinii czytelników)

Oryginalny tytuł:

Automate the Boring Stuff with Python, 2nd Edition: Practical Programming for Total Beginners

Zawartość książki:

Drugie wydanie tej bestsellerowej książki o Pythonie (ponad 100 000 sprzedanych egzemplarzy w samym druku) wykorzystuje Pythona 3, aby nauczyć nawet osoby niezaawansowane technicznie, jak pisać programy, które w ciągu kilku minut robią to, co ręcznie zajęłoby godziny. Nie jest wymagane wcześniejsze doświadczenie w programowaniu, a książka jest uwielbiana zarówno przez absolwentów sztuk wyzwolonych, jak i geeków.

Jeśli kiedykolwiek spędziłeś godziny na zmienianiu nazw plików lub aktualizowaniu setek komórek arkusza kalkulacyjnego, wiesz, jak żmudne mogą być takie zadania. A gdyby tak komputer mógł wykonać je za ciebie? W tym w pełni zaktualizowanym drugim wydaniu bestsellerowego klasyka Automate the Boring Stuff with Python dowiesz się, jak używać Pythona do pisania programów, które w ciągu kilku minut wykonają to, co ręcznie zajęłoby ci godziny - bez konieczności posiadania wcześniejszego doświadczenia w programowaniu. Poznasz podstawy Pythona i odkryjesz bogatą bibliotekę modułów Pythona do wykonywania określonych zadań, takich jak pobieranie danych ze stron internetowych, czytanie dokumentów PDF i Word oraz automatyzacja klikania i wpisywania zadań. Drugie wydanie tej ulubionej przez międzynarodowych fanów książki zawiera zupełnie nowy rozdział poświęcony walidacji danych wejściowych, a także samouczki dotyczące automatyzacji Gmaila i Arkuszy Google oraz wskazówki dotyczące automatycznego aktualizowania plików CSV. Dowiesz się, jak tworzyć programy, które bez wysiłku wykonują przydatne wyczyny automatyzacji, aby:

- Wyszukiwać tekst w pliku lub w wielu plikach.

- Tworzyć, aktualizować, przenosić i zmieniać nazwy plików i folderów.

- Przeszukiwać sieć i pobierać treści online.

- Aktualizować i formatować dane w arkuszach kalkulacyjnych Excel o dowolnym rozmiarze.

- Dzielić, scalać, oznaczać znakiem wodnym i szyfrować pliki PDF.

- Wysyłanie odpowiedzi e-mail i powiadomień tekstowych.

- Wypełnianie formularzy online Instrukcje krok po kroku przeprowadzą Cię przez każdy program, a zaktualizowane projekty praktyczne na końcu każdego rozdziału stanowią wyzwanie do ulepszenia tych programów i wykorzystania nowo nabytych umiejętności do automatyzacji podobnych zadań. Nie trać czasu na wykonywanie pracy, którą mogłaby wykonać dobrze wyszkolona małpa. Nawet jeśli nigdy nie napisałeś ani linijki kodu, możesz sprawić, że komputer wykona za ciebie całą pracę. Dowiedz się jak to zrobić w książce Automate the Boring Stuff with Python, 2nd Edition.

Dodatkowe informacje o książce:

ISBN:9781593279929
Autor:
Wydawca:
Oprawa:Miękka oprawa
Rok wydania:2019
Liczba stron:500

Zakup:

Obecnie dostępne, na stanie.

Inne książki autora:

Poza podstawowymi rzeczami z Pythonem: Najlepsze praktyki pisania czystego kodu - Beyond the Basic...
Przejdź od początkującego programisty do...
Poza podstawowymi rzeczami z Pythonem: Najlepsze praktyki pisania czystego kodu - Beyond the Basic Stuff with Python: Best Practices for Writing Clean Code
Scratch 3 Programming Playground: Naucz się programować, tworząc fajne gry - Scratch 3 Programming...
Wypełnione projektami wprowadzenie do kodowania,...
Scratch 3 Programming Playground: Naucz się programować, tworząc fajne gry - Scratch 3 Programming Playground: Learn to Program by Making Cool Games
Twórz własne gry komputerowe w Pythonie, 4e - Invent Your Own Computer Games with Python,...
Invent Your Own Computer Games with Python nauczy cię, jak...
Twórz własne gry komputerowe w Pythonie, 4e - Invent Your Own Computer Games with Python, 4e
Kodowanie w Minecrafcie: Buduj wyżej, gospodaruj szybciej, wydobywaj głębiej i zautomatyzuj nudne...
Praktyczne wprowadzenie do kodowania, które uczy,...
Kodowanie w Minecrafcie: Buduj wyżej, gospodaruj szybciej, wydobywaj głębiej i zautomatyzuj nudne rzeczy - Coding with Minecraft: Build Taller, Farm Faster, Mine Deeper, and Automate the Boring Stuff
Automate the Boring Stuff with Python, 2nd Edition: Praktyczne programowanie dla początkujących -...
Drugie wydanie tej bestsellerowej książki o...
Automate the Boring Stuff with Python, 2nd Edition: Praktyczne programowanie dla początkujących - Automate the Boring Stuff with Python, 2nd Edition: Practical Programming for Total Beginners
Cracking Codes with Python: Wprowadzenie do tworzenia i łamania szyfrów - Cracking Codes with...
Dowiedz się, jak programować w Pythonie, tworząc i...
Cracking Codes with Python: Wprowadzenie do tworzenia i łamania szyfrów - Cracking Codes with Python: An Introduction to Building and Breaking Ciphers
Wielka księga małych projektów w Pythonie: 81 łatwych programów ćwiczeniowych - The Big Book of...
Wdrażaj Pythona kreatywnie i efektywnie dzięki...
Wielka księga małych projektów w Pythonie: 81 łatwych programów ćwiczeniowych - The Big Book of Small Python Projects: 81 Easy Practice Programs
The Recursive Book of Recursion: Jak zdać egzamin z kodowania w Pythonie i JavaScripcie - The...
Przystępny, ale rygorystyczny kurs programowania...
The Recursive Book of Recursion: Jak zdać egzamin z kodowania w Pythonie i JavaScripcie - The Recursive Book of Recursion: Ace the Coding Interview with Python and JavaScript

Prace autora wydały następujące wydawnictwa:

© Book1 Group - wszelkie prawa zastrzeżone.
Zawartość tej strony nie może być kopiowana ani wykorzystywana w całości lub w części bez pisemnej zgody właściciela.
Ostatnia aktualizacja: 2024.11.13 21:45 (GMT)